About H.S. Sane
H.S. Sane is a scholar working on Control and Systems Engineering, Electrical and Electronic Engineering, Atomic and Molecular Physics, and Optics, Computational Mechanics and Biomedical Engineering, having authored 25 papers that have together received 337 indexed citations. Recurring topics across this work include Advanced Control Systems Optimization (9 papers), Advanced MEMS and NEMS Technologies (8 papers), Mechanical and Optical Resonators (8 papers), Adaptive Control of Nonlinear Systems (6 papers), Control Systems and Identification (5 papers), Stability and Controllability of Differential Equations (3 papers), Advanced Adaptive Filtering Techniques (3 papers) and Extremum Seeking Control Systems (3 papers). The work is most often cited by research in Control and Systems Engineering (147 citations), Atomic and Molecular Physics, and Optics (92 citations), Building and Construction (37 citations), Computer Networks and Communications (65 citations) and Electrical and Electronic Engineering (130 citations). H.S. Sane has collaborated with scholars based in United States, Canada and Japan. Frequent co-authors include Dennis S. Bernstein, Carlos H. Mastrangelo, N. Yazdi, Scott A. Bortoff, Ravinder Venugopal, Martin Guay, Kshitij Doshi, Anup Mohan, Vipin Tyagi and Swaroop Darbha. Their work appears in journals such as IEEE Transactions on Control Systems Technology, Annual Reviews in Control, AIAA Guidance, Navigation, and Control Conference and Exhibit, Deep Blue (University of Michigan) and Proceedings of SPIE, the International Society for Optical Engineering/Proceedings of SPIE.
